* { margin:0; padding:0;}
a{text-decoration:none;color:#333333;}
a:hover{text-decoration:none;color:#bd0a01;}
img {border:0;}
ul,li{margin:0;padding:0;list-style:none;}
.Header { width:100%; height:77px; background:url("v_head_bg.jpg");}
.Header .inner { width:980px; clear:both; margin:0 auto;}
.Header .inner .logo { float:left; text-align:left; margin-top:10px; border:0px solid blue;}

.Header .inner .Search {margin-top:20px;float:right;}
.Search { height:31px; float:right;}
.Search .keyword { width:260px; height:19px; line-height:19px; padding:4px; border:2px solid #5A5959; float:left;}
.Search .submit { width:78px; height:31px; border:0; background:url("v_btn_search.jpg"); cursor:pointer; float:left;}

.Nav { width:100%; height:40px; line-height:40px; background-color:#222222;}
.Nav .inner { width:980px; margin:0 auto; }
.Nav .inner ul li { float:left; }
.Nav .inner ul li a { font-size:14px; color:#FFFFFF; padding:0px 15px;}
.Nav .inner ul li a:hover { color:#FFFFFF; display:block; background-color:#3C3C3C; }
.Nav .inner ul li.focus a { display:block; background-color:#C61A14; }
.Nav .inner ul li.focus { position:relative; z-index:1;}
.Nav .inner ul li.focus div { width:980px; height:35px; background-color:#3C3C3C; position:absolute; left:-58px; z-index:2; display:none;}
.Nav .inner ul li.focus dl {  margin-left:58px; }
.Nav .inner ul li.focus dd { float:left; }
.Nav .inner ul li.focus dd a { display:block; line-height:35px; color:#FFFFFF; background-color:#3C3C3C;}

.Part1 { width:980px; height:420px; padding-top:8px; margin:0 auto;clear:both;}
.Part2 { width:980px; margin:0 auto;clear:both;}
.Part3 { width:980px; margin:0 auto;clear:both;}


/* ========== 首页 ========== */
.PanelFlash { float:left;}
.PlayBar { width:652px; height:37px; background:url("v_play_bg.jpg");float:left; position:absolute; top:530px;}


/* 幻灯片 右面*/
.Tab02 { float:right;}
.Tab02 { width:320px; font-size:12px; }
.Tab02 .head { height:34px; font-size:14px; border-right:1px solid #DDDDDD; }
.Tab02 .head li { width:90px; height:34px; line-height:34px; float:left; border-left:1px solid #DDDDDD; text-align:center; cursor:pointer; }
.Tab02 .head li { background:url("Tab02_head_bg.gif");}
.Tab02 .head li.on { background:url("Tab02_head_bg_on.gif"); font-weight:bold; }
.Tab02 .head li.end { width:136px; height:34px; border-left:1px solid #DDDDDD;} 
.Tab02 .body { border:1px solid #DDDDDD; border-top:none; padding:10px;}
.Tab02 .body .content li { height:29px; line-height:29px; border-top:1px #DDDDDD solid; }
.Tab02 .body .content li span { float:right; color:#787878;}

.Tab02 .body .content li.img { height:90px; border-top:0px blue solid;}
.Tab02 .body .content li.img img { float:left; width:120px; height:70px; }
.Tab02 .body .content li.img p { width:170px; float:right; padding-left:2px; line-height:20px; text-align:left;}



/* 最新视频 */
.P301 { width:650px; font-size:12px; border:1px solid #DADADA; float:left;}
.P301 .head { height:25px; line-height:25px;}
.P301 .head h3{ float:left; font-size:14px; text-indent:10px; }
.P301 .head .more { float:right; margin-right:20px;}
.P301 .body { clear:both; text-align:left;}
.P301 .body ul { width:162px; height:138px; text-align:center; float:left;}
.P301 .body li { text-align:center; line-height:18px; overflow:hidden; }
.P301 .body li img { width:130px; height:80px; border:1px solid #DADADA; padding:4px; }
.P301 .body li.img { width:150px; overflow:hidden; }
.P301 .body li.tit { width:140px; height:40px; line-height:20px; overflow:hidden;}

.P302 { float:right;}
.P302 ul { margin-top:-5px;}
.P302 ul li { padding-top:5px; }
.P302 ul li img { width:318px; height:93px; border:1px solid #ccc;}


/* 资讯 晚会 体育 电视台 */
.P303 { width:650px; font-size:12px; float:left;}
.P303 .head { width:650px; height:25px; line-height:25px; border-bottom:2px solid #DADADA;}
.P303 .head h3{ float:left; font-size:14px; text-indent:10px; }
.P303 .head .more { float:right; margin-right:20px;}
.P303 .body { clear:both; text-align:left; margin-top:5px; padding-left:8px;}
.P303 .body ul { width:160px; margin-top:10px; float:left; overflow:hidden;height:120px;}
.P303 .body li { width:140px; float:left; display:inline; text-align:left; line-height:16px; margin-left:10px;overflow:hidden; }
.P303 .body li img { width:130px; height:80px; border:1px solid #DADADA; padding:4px; }
.P303 .body li.tit { line-height:14px;}

.P304 { width:315px; font-size:12px; border:#F4F4F4 1px solid; float:right;}
.P304 .head { height:25px; line-height:25px; background-color:#F2F2F2; clear:both; }
.P304 .head h3 { font-size:12px; text-indent:8px; float:left; }
.P304 .head h3 a { color:#0a75a6; text-decoration:none; }
.P304 .head h3 a:hover { color:#0a75a6; text-decoration:none; }
.P304 .head .more { float:right; margin-right:10px; }
.P304 .body { padding:8px; }
.P304 .body ul { background:url("v_ul_h25.gif") 0 6px no-repeat;}
.P304 .body li { list-style-type:none; text-indent:20px; height:25px; line-height:25px; overflow:hidden; }
.P304 a { color:#16387c; text-decoration:none; }
.P304 a:hover { color:#ff3300; text-decoration:underline; }


.Location { width:980px; height:35px; line-height:35px; text-align:left; clear:both; margin:0 auto; }

.PList { width:980px; margin:0 auto; }
.PList ul { width:163px; margin-top:2px; float:left;}
.PList ul { text-align:center;}
.PList ul { border-bottom:1px dashed #ccc; }
.PList ul li { width:150px; text-align:left; line-height:20px; overflow:hidden;}
.PList ul li img { width:130px; height:80px; border:1px solid #ccc; padding:4px;}
.PList ul li.tit { height:40px; }
.PList ul li.hits { height:25px; color:#787878;}


/* ========== 播放页 ========== */
.PVideo { width:652px; float:left;}
.PVideo .share { width:652px; height:20px; line-height:20px; background-color:#222222; color:#fff; text-indent:10px; padding-top:5px;}
.PVideo .share a { line-height:20px; color:#fff;}

/* 播放页，播放器右侧 */
.PKanDian { width:320px; float:right;}
.PKanDian .body { height:485px; padding-top:10px; overflow:hidden;}
.PKanDian .body .inner { width:320px; height:490px; overflow-y:auto;}
.PKanDian ul { width:300px; clear:both;}
.PKanDian li.img { height:90px; float:left;}
.PKanDian li.img img { width:108px; height:74px; border:1px solid #ccc; padding:2px;}
.PKanDian li.tit { width:175px; text-align:left; white-space:nowrap; overflow:hidden; float:right;}
.PKanDian li.txt { width:175px; text-align:left; color:#808080; overflow:hidden; float:right;}


/* 大屏播放页，播放器下面 */
.PKanDian2 { width:980px; margin:0 auto; margin-top:8px; border:1px solid #DEDEDE;}
.PKanDian2 .head { height:33px; line-height:33px; background:url("v_bar_bg.gif");}
.PKanDian2 .head h3{ float:left; font-size:14px; text-indent:10px; }
.PKanDian2 .body {  height:115px; padding:8px; overflow:hidden;}
.PKanDian2 .body .inner { width:960px; height:115px; overflow-x:auto;}
.PKanDian2 ul { width:258px; }
.PKanDian2 li.img { height:90px; float:left;}
.PKanDian2 li.img img { width:108px; height:74px; border:1px solid #ccc; padding:2px;}
.PKanDian2 li.tit { width:135px; text-align:left; white-space:nowrap; overflow:hidden; float:right;}
.PKanDian2 li.txt { width:135px; text-align:left; color:#808080; overflow:hidden; float:right;}


.PInfo { width:650px; border:1px solid #DEDEDE; float:left;}
.PInfo .head { height:33px; line-height:33px; background:url("v_bar_bg.gif");}
.PInfo .head h3{ float:left; font-size:14px; text-indent:10px; }
.PInfo .body { padding:5px; }
.PInfo .body p { line-height:22px; color:#787878;}

.PComment { width:650px; border:1px solid #DEDEDE; margin-top:10px; float:left;}
.PComment .head { height:33px; line-height:33px; background:url("v_bar_bg.gif");}
.PComment .head h3{ float:left; font-size:14px; text-indent:10px; }
.PComment .body { padding:10px 5px; }
.PComment .body p { line-height:22px; color:#787878;}


.PartWanHui { width:100%; height:533px; background-color:#000000; }

.Blank2 { width:980px; height:2px; margin:0 auto; font-size:0px; clear:both;}
.Blank { width:980px; height:10px; margin:0 auto; font-size:0; clear:both; }